Domestic Abuse

Order for Protection

If you are the victim of domestic violence, you can ask the city or county attorney to file a criminal complaint. You also have the right to go to court and file a petition requesting an Order for Protection from domestic abuse.

The order could include the following:
  • An order retaining the abuser from further acts of abuse
  • An order directing the abuser to leave your household
  • An order preventing the abuser from entering your residence, school, business place of employment
  • An order awarding you or the other parent custody of or visitation with your minor children if the abuser has a legal obligation to do so
  • An order directing the abuser to pay support to you and the minor children if the abuser has a legal obligation to do so
